Whidbey Island
Whidbey Island is a large island in the northwest corner of Washington State, located in Island County, Washington.
It is connected to the mainland by a bridge over Deception Pass at the northern end and by ferry links at the south end (Clinton to Mukilteo) and the western shore (Keystone[?] to Port Townsend, on the Olympic Peninsula[?]).
Whidbey Island is home to Whidbey Island Naval Air Station[?] and is renowned for Penn Cove[?] mussels.
